What is the meaning of the name Barikah ?

The baby name Barikah is a Female name , 3 syllables long and is pronounced bah-RAH-kah (IPA: /ba.ra.kah/).

Barikah is Arabic in Origin.

Barikah is a feminine given name of Arabic origin, linked to the Semitic root B-R-K meaning “blessing,” “divine favor,” and by extension “prosperity” or “abundance.” It corresponds to Arabic Barakah (baraka) and reflects an alternate vocalization/transliteration where i replaces the unstressed a. The final -ah marks a feminine form in Arabic, so Barikah typically reads as “she who is blessed” or “full of blessing.”

The name has circulated widely across Muslim communities from the Middle East to North and sub‑Saharan Africa, appearing in court records and family lineages from medieval times to the present. Usage is especially familiar in Hausa- and Swahili‑speaking regions, where related forms are common and sometimes unisex. Variants include Barakah, Baraka, and Barika; related names are Mubarak/Mubaarak (“blessed”). Cognates from the same root include Hebrew Baruch and Berakhah and Turkish/Amharic Bereket. Possible short forms: Bari, Rika.
